40 Films in Robotech: A Road in India (1938)
ROBOTECH MENTION:
In Robotech – The Macross Saga Episode 35 entitled Season’s Greetings, “Road to India” is on a movie theater marquee in New Macross city. While this isn't an exact title match, it's close enough for us - especially since we couldn't find "Road to India" in the usual online movie databases.

AWARDS & KUDOS:
Masterful Technicolor cameraman Jack Cardiff was the cinematographer on A Road in India. Cardiff went on to win an Oscar for his cinematography work in Black Narcissus (1947).According to IMDB, A Road to India was part of United Artists’ “A Worldwide Window” series, which was set up to compete with MGM’s popular “Traveltalks” film series.
